This module consolidates students’ subject knowledge and understanding related to English (with particular emphasis on children’s development as readers), mathematics and science.
Subject knowledge and understanding will underpin students’ capacity to plan and teach extended units of work, embedding assessments for formative purposes as per relevant national frameworks and structures.
This module requires students to apply their subject knowledge and practical experience (pedagogical content knowledge) related to the curriculum subjects English, mathematics and science. The module assignment invites students to critically evaluate aspects of those subjects as they relate to key themes of, for example:
• the primary curriculum and national frameworks
• curriculum development
• teacher knowledge
• subject leadership
• thinking skills
• direct instruction, memory, practice and “associative” learning
• social constructivism and “assisted” learning towards self-regulation
• motivation and learning
• language and learning
• collaborative learning
etc.
